In other words, interpreting converts the meaning of the source language into the target language. Interpreting takes place in many settings and for many reasons, yet at heart the purpose of interpreting is to facilitate communication between parties who do not share a common language.

Language interpretation - Wikipedia. Interpreting is translation from a spoken or signed language into another language, usually in real time to facilitate live communication. It is distinguished from the translation of a written text, which can be more deliberative and make use of external resources and tools. INTERPRETING definition | Cambridge English Dictionary.
